What are TG Roster Points for Direct Recruitment and Promotions?
TG Roster Points for Direct Recruitment and Promotions are numerical positions assigned to vacancies. Each roster point corresponds to a reservation category. When departments notify vacancies, appointments are made according to the roster sequence. This ensures proper implementation of the reservation percentages prescribed by the Telangana Government.
For example, certain roster points are allotted to SC categories, some to ST categories, others to BC groups, and several to the Open Category. EWS, Sports Quota, Ex-Servicemen, and disability reservations are also integrated into the roster system. As recruitment progresses, appointments follow the roster order without disturbing reservation balances.

Telangana 100 Point Roster System
The Telangana 100 Point Roster is one complete cycle consisting of 100 roster positions. Each position is assigned to a category according to reservation rules. Once 100 points are completed, the cycle begins again from the first point. This method ensures long-term reservation balance and proper category representation.

How TG Direct Recruitment Roster Points Work?
Whenever a department identifies vacancies, the appointing authority checks the next available roster point. The category attached to that roster point determines which reservation category the vacancy belongs to. Selection is then made according to recruitment rules and eligibility conditions.
For example, if a vacancy falls under a roster point earmarked for BC-B, then the vacancy is treated as a BC-B reserved post. Similarly, if the roster point belongs to SC, ST, EWS, Sports, or another reservation category, the appointment is made accordingly.
This method helps maintain reservation percentages throughout the recruitment process and prevents arbitrary allocation of vacancies.
TG Employees Promotions Roster Points
TG Employees Promotions Roster Points play an important role in departmental promotions. Promotion rosters are maintained separately according to applicable service rules and reservation provisions. Departments maintain roster registers to track vacancies, appointments, and promotional opportunities.
Promotion rosters help ensure that eligible employees from reserved categories receive opportunities according to applicable government orders. The roster register becomes an important administrative record during promotion counseling, seniority verification, and vacancy calculation.

SC/ST Roster Points in Promotions
SC and ST reservation categories receive specific roster points within the 100-point cycle. These positions are distributed across the roster to ensure balanced representation. Departments verify roster positions before issuing promotion orders and appointment proceedings.
SC and ST roster implementation is subject to applicable court judgments, government orders, reservation policies, and departmental guidelines. Therefore, employees should always verify the latest government instructions before relying on any roster position for promotion claims.

Roster Points 1 – 100
| 1 | OC |
| 2 | SC, G-II |
| 3 | OC |
| 4 | BC-A |
| 5 | OC |
| 6 | VH |
| 7 | SC, G-I |
| 8 | ST |
| 9 | EWS |
| 10 | BC-B |
| 11 | OC |
| 12 | OC |
| 13 | EX-S / OC |
| 14 | BC-C |
| 15 | ST |
| 16 | SC, G-II |
| 17 | EWS |
| 18 | BC-D |
| 19 | BC-E |
| 20 | BC-A |
| 21 | OC |
| 22 | SC, G-III |
| 23 | OC |
| 24 | BC-B |
| 25 | ST |
| 26 | OC |
| 27 | SC, G-II |
| 28 | EWS |
| 29 | BC-A |
| 30 | OC |
| 31 | HH |
| 32 | OC |
| 33 | ST |
| 34 | OC |
| 35 | BC-B |
| 36 | EWS |
| 37 | EX-S / OC |
| 38 | OC |
| 39 | BC-D |
| 40 | OC |
| 41 | SC, G-III |
| 42 | ST |
| 43 | BC-D |
| 44 | BC-E |
| 45 | BC-A |
| 46 | OC |
| 47 | SC, G-II |
| 48 | SPORTS |
| 49 | BC-B |
| 50 | EWS |
| 51 | OC |
| 52 | SC, G-II |
| 53 | OC |
| 54 | BC-A |
| 55 | OC |
| 56 | OH |
| 57 | EWS |
| 58 | ST |
| 59 | OC |
| 60 | BC-B |
| 61 | OC |
| 62 | SC, G-III |
| 63 | OC |
| 64 | BC-D |
| 65 | EWS |
| 66 | SC, G-II |
| 67 | ST |
| 68 | BC-D |
| 69 | BC-E |
| 70 | BC-A |
| 71 | OC |
| 72 | SC, G-II |
| 73 | OC |
| 74 | BC-B |
| 75 | ST |
| 76 | EWS |
| 77 | SC, G-III |
| 78 | OC |
| 79 | BC-A |
| 80 | OC |
| 81 | BC-B |
| 82 | MH |
| 83 | ST |
| 84 | OC |
| 85 | BC-B |
| 86 | EWS |
| 87 | SC, G-II |
| 88 | OC |
| 89 | BC-D |
| 90 | OC |
| 91 | SC, G-III |
| 92 | ST |
| 93 | BC-D |
| 94 | BC-E |
| 95 | BC-B |
| 96 | OC |
| 97 | SC, G-II |
| 98 | SPORTS |
| 99 | BC-B |
| 100 | EWS |
How to Calculate TG Roster Points?
- Identify the total sanctioned posts.
- Verify the existing roster register.
- Locate the last filled roster point.
- Determine the next roster point.
- Identify the reservation category attached to that point.
- Fill the vacancy according to the recruitment rules.
- Update the roster register after the appointment.
This process ensures proper reservation implementation and avoids mistakes in vacancy allocation. Departments generally maintain roster registers and service records for this purpose.
